This is one of my Granny's old recipes. Moist, tender, and yummy coconut flavor. Ingredients:
1 cup margarine, softened |
1/2 cup shortening |
3 cups sugar |
6 eggs |
3 cups all-purpose flour |
1 cup milk |
1 teaspoon coconut flavoring |
1 teaspoon almond flavoring |
1 (3 1/2 ounce) can flaked coconut |
Directions:
1. In a mixing bowl, cream the margarine, shortening, and sugar. 2. Add the eggs, one at a time, beating 2 minutes after each. 3. Add flour alternately with milk; mix to combine. 4. Stir in the flavorings and coconut until well mixed. 5. Pour batter into a well greased 10-inch tube pan. 6. Bake in a non-preheated oven at 350° for 1 hour and 15 minutes or until pick comes out clean. |
